    Mini across clues and answers

    1A clue: Like some weather, memories and I.P.A.s
    Answer: HAZY

    5A clue: Statement that’s self-evidently true
    Answer: AXIOM

    7A clue: Civic automaker
    Answer: HONDA

    8A clue: What fear leads to, as Yoda told a young Anakin
    Answer: ANGER

    9A clue: Foxlike
    Answer: SLY

    Mini down clues and answers

    1D clue: Verbal «lol»
    Answer: HAHA

    2D clue: Brain signal transmitter
    Answer: AXON

    3D clue: Hits with a witty comeback
    Answer: ZINGS

    4D clue: Sing at the top of a mountain, maybe
    Answer: YODEL

    6D clue: Name of the famous «Queen of Scots»
    Answer: MARY
